    LMS on Ubuntu 12.04

    Hi, I've installed LMS for my Squeezebox on Ubuntu 12.04, which will be my new media server. How can I tell LMS to look in the default 'music' folder for the files? It dioesn't seem to see them by default, unless I add the folders to the Playlist. Any help much appreciated!

    And if you can't browse to that folder , have a look at the permissions for the directories and files LMS is it own user and may not have the rigth read anything your user directory .

    And do a clear and rescan everything afterwards
